Traffic Flow and Safety: Regarding stop lights, are there specific roads where stop lights could be better aligned?

  • Resident Guidance: Through a statistically projectable survey, 18% of residents voiced concerns about traffic congestion and safety, especially at major intersections. This was the most concerning topic for survey responders. Common phrases heard over the past year at events and online included aligning the timing of stop lights, traffic congestion, and traffic planning with anticipated growth.
  • Existing Condition: OV’s major roads have sufficient capacity to support the additional projected population but improvements are required over time.
